企业级案例分析:Gamma软件在Ubuntu环境下的企业应用剖析

发布时间: 2024-12-22 03:13:12 阅读量: 5 订阅数: 6
DOC

Ubuntu下安装gamma软件的步骤

![企业级案例分析:Gamma软件在Ubuntu环境下的企业应用剖析](https://tigersheet.com/wp-content/uploads/2019/04/report-generation-1024x428.png) # 摘要 本文综合介绍了Gamma软件的企业级应用、在Ubuntu环境下的部署、功能和工作原理、实践应用案例、性能调优与维护,以及软件的未来展望和市场战略。文章首先概述了Gamma软件在企业中的应用范畴和价值,详细阐述了在Ubuntu环境下的部署流程、配置细节以及解决部署过程中的常见问题。接着,深入探讨了Gamma软件的核心功能、高级特性和技术架构,分析了软件如何与企业日常业务结合,并提出了定制化开发的策略。此外,文章还提供了性能监控、优化策略和长期维护计划的实用指导。最后,结合行业趋势,探讨了Gamma软件的未来发展方向以及市场战略和合作伙伴关系的构建。整体上,本文为读者提供了一个全面理解和有效应用Gamma软件的框架。 # 关键字 Gamma软件;企业级应用;Ubuntu部署;功能工作原理;性能调优;市场战略 参考资源链接:[Ubuntu下Gamma软件安装教程:Linux干涉处理必备](https://wenku.csdn.net/doc/6412b6ebbe7fbd1778d4872b?spm=1055.2635.3001.10343) # 1. Gamma软件的企业级应用概述 企业级应用要求软件能够在复杂的商业环境中稳定、高效地运行,以满足企业不断变化的业务需求。Gamma软件作为一款先进的企业级解决方案,它集成了强大的数据处理、智能分析和自动化流程管理功能,特别适合于需要处理大规模数据和复杂业务逻辑的场景。本章节将概述Gamma软件的基本功能、企业级应用场景以及为何它成为行业内的一个优选。 ## 1.1 Gamma软件的基本功能 Gamma软件提供了一系列核心功能,包括但不限于: - **数据集成**:支持多种数据源接入,轻松实现数据的合并与同步。 - **工作流自动化**:通过自定义的工作流程减少手动操作,提高效率和减少错误。 - **智能分析**:利用高级算法进行数据分析和预测,辅助决策制定。 ## 1.2 企业级应用场景 在企业级应用中,Gamma软件能够解决多种行业问题: - **金融**:用于信贷风险管理、欺诈检测和客户数据分析。 - **医疗保健**:通过患者数据整合提供个性化治疗计划。 - **零售**:分析市场趋势和消费者行为,优化库存和销售策略。 ## 1.3 选择Gamma软件的理由 选择Gamma软件的原因在于它具备以下优势: - **强大的扩展性**:可以扩展以满足不断增长的业务需求。 - **高度的定制性**:提供灵活的配置选项,以适应特定企业的特定需求。 - **易于集成**:支持与现有企业软件的无缝集成。 在接下来的章节中,我们将深入了解在Ubuntu环境下部署Gamma软件的步骤和细节,以及如何最大化地利用其功能来满足企业级应用的具体需求。 # 2. Ubuntu环境下的Gamma软件部署 ## 2.1 Ubuntu环境搭建和配置 ### 2.1.1 Ubuntu系统的选择和安装 Ubuntu作为开源社区中广泛使用的Linux发行版之一,深受开发人员和系统管理员的欢迎。对于希望部署Gamma软件的企业来说,选择一个稳定且具有长期支持(LTS)版本的Ubuntu系统是至关重要的步骤。例如,Ubuntu 20.04 LTS作为最新的长期支持版本,其拥有为期五年的软件更新和安全补丁支持,为Gamma软件提供了一个可靠的操作平台。 安装Ubuntu的过程相对直接,首先需要下载Ubuntu 20.04 LTS的ISO镜像文件。接下来,可以通过刻录到USB驱动器或者使用虚拟光驱在虚拟机中加载安装镜像,开始安装过程。安装时,用户需要选择合适的语言、时区、键盘布局,并设置用户名和密码。对于企业环境,建议选择最小化安装,以避免不必要的软件包占用系统资源。 ``` # 使用dd命令将ISO镜像写入USB驱动器 sudo dd if=path/to/ubuntu-20.04.1 LTS-desktop-amd64.iso of=/dev/sdx status=progress && sync ``` ### 2.1.2 系统安全性和权限设置 安装完Ubuntu系统之后,接下来需要确保系统的安全性,特别是对于企业级应用,安全性的考量更需严格。系统管理员需要更改默认的SSH端口,禁用root登录,并设置密码策略,以提高系统的抗攻击能力。此外,使用UFW(Uncomplicated Firewall)可以简单有效地管理防火墙规则,对端口访问进行限制。 ``` # 更改SSH默认端口 sudo sed -i 's/^Port 22/Port 2222/g' /etc/ssh/sshd_config sudo service ssh restart # 禁用root登录 sudo sed -i 's/^PermitRootLogin prohibit-password/PermitRootLogin no/' /etc/ssh/sshd_config sudo service ssh restart # 设置UFW防火墙规则 sudo ufw allow 2222/tcp sudo ufw allow http sudo ufw allow https sudo ufw enable ``` 同时,为了遵循最小权限原则,建议根据需求创建不同的用户,并为每个用户分配适当的权限。例如,安装和管理Gamma软件的用户应具备sudo权限,而应用运行的用户则不应具备管理权限。 ## 2.2 Gamma软件的安装与配置 ### 2.2.1 Gamma软件的下载与安装步骤 Gamma软件的官方发布包通常可以在官方网站或者通过特定的软件仓库获得。使用wget或curl命令可以方便地下载Gamma软件的安装包,随后需要根据软件包的格式(如deb或rpm)使用相应的命令进行安装。 ``` # 使用wget下载Gamma软件 wget http://example.com/gamma-software-version.tar.gz # 解压缩下载的文件 tar -xvzf gamma-software-version.tar.gz # 进入解压后的目录 cd gamma-software-version # 执行安装脚本,安装Gamma软件 sudo ./install.sh ``` ### 2.2.2 Gamma软件配置文件详解 Gamma软件的配置文件通常位于`/etc/gamma/`目录下,主要的配置文件`gamma.conf`包含了软件运行所需的各项参数。管理员需要根据企业的实际环境配置相应的参数,如数据库连接信息、监听地址、端口等。 ``` # 配置文件gamma.conf中部分内容 database { host: localhost user: gamma_user password: secret database: gamma_db } server { listen_address: 127.0.0.1 listen_port: 8080 ... } ``` ### 2.2.3 软件依赖和插件管理 Gamma软件可能依赖于一系列的第三方库和插件。管理这些依赖项的最好方式之一是使用包管理器,例如在Ubuntu中使用apt。管理员可以通过添加PPA(个人软件包档案)或者配置源列表来安装这些依赖和插件。 ``` # 添加Gamma软件的PPA源并更新软件包列表 sudo add-apt-repository ppa:gamma-software/ppa sudo apt update # 安装依赖的库和插件 sudo apt install gamma-dependency-plugin1 gamma-dependency-library2 ``` ## 2.3 部署过程中的常见问题与解决方案 ### 2.3.1 兼容性和性能问题 兼容性问题通常出现在新的Gamma软件版本与旧系统或者特定硬件不兼容的情况。如果遇到性能瓶颈,可能需要考虑升级硬件,或者调整系统和Gamma软件的配置参数以提高效率。 ``` # 检查系统硬件信息 lshw -c video # 调整Linux内核参数以提高性能 echo "vm.max_map_count = 262144" | sudo tee -a /etc/sysctl.conf sudo sysctl -p ``` ### 2.3.2 部署过程中的故障排除 部署过程中可能会遇到各种故障,如安装失败、服务启动不了等。有效排查故障的第一步是查看日志文件,通常位于`/var/log/gamma/`目录。通过分析日志文件可以定位问题所在,例如权限问题、配置错误等。 ``` # 查看Gamma软件的日志文件 tail -f /var/log/gamma/gamma-service.log ``` 针对常见的部署问题,Gamma软件官方提供了详细的故障排除文档。管理员应当仔细阅读官方文档,了解各种可能的问题及其解决方案。 ``` # 访问Gamma软件的官方故障排除指南 # 注意:URL为示例,具体URL需替换为官方实际地址 google-chrome 'http://gamma-software.com/docs/troubleshooting' ``` 以上章节内容为第二章的详细介绍,接下来将展示第三章的内容,该章节将深入分析Gamma软件的核心功能、高级特性与优势,以及其技术架构。 # 3. Gamma软件的功能与工作原理 在探讨Gamma软件的企业级应用时,理解其功能和工作原理是至关重要的。这不仅能帮助IT从业者更好地评估软件是否满足企业需求,还能指导企业有效地利用软件资源,
corwn 最低0.47元/天 解锁专栏
买1年送3月
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

SW_孙维

开发技术专家
知名科技公司工程师,开发技术领域拥有丰富的工作经验和专业知识。曾负责设计和开发多个复杂的软件系统,涉及到大规模数据处理、分布式系统和高性能计算等方面。
专栏简介
这篇专栏为 Ubuntu 用户提供了有关安装和配置 Gamma 软件的全面指南。从安装前的准备到命令行和图形界面安装方法,再到解决依赖问题、确保软件最新、优化性能以及备份和恢复策略,本专栏涵盖了所有方面。此外,它还探讨了企业环境中 Gamma 软件的应用,为用户提供了全面且实用的资源,以充分利用 Gamma 软件在 Ubuntu 系统中的功能。
最低0.47元/天 解锁专栏
买1年送3月
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

【Rose工具高级使用技巧】:让你的设计更上一层楼

![使用Rose画状态图与活动图的说明书](https://media.geeksforgeeks.org/wp-content/uploads/20240113170006/state-machine-diagram-banner.jpg) # 摘要 本文全面介绍了Rose工具的入门知识、深入理解和高级模型设计。从基础的界面布局到UML图解和项目管理,再到高级的类图设计、行为建模以及架构组件图的优化,文章为读者提供了一个系统学习和掌握Rose工具的完整路径。此外,还探讨了Rose工具在代码生成、逆向工程以及协同工作和共享方面的应用,为软件工程师提供了一系列实践技巧和案例分析。文章旨在帮助读

【SAT文件实战指南】:快速诊断错误与优化性能,确保数据万无一失

![【SAT文件实战指南】:快速诊断错误与优化性能,确保数据万无一失](https://slideplayer.com/slide/15716320/88/images/29/Semantic+(Logic)+Error.jpg) # 摘要 SAT文件作为一种重要的数据交换格式,在多个领域中被广泛应用,其正确性与性能直接影响系统的稳定性和效率。本文旨在深入解析SAT文件的基础知识,探讨其结构和常见错误类型,并介绍理论基础下的错误诊断方法。通过实践操作,文章将指导读者使用诊断工具进行错误定位和修复,并分析性能瓶颈,提供优化策略。最后,探讨SAT文件在实际应用中的维护方法,包括数据安全、备份和持

【MATLAB M_map数据可视化秘籍】:专家案例分析与实践最佳实践

![【MATLAB M_map数据可视化秘籍】:专家案例分析与实践最佳实践](https://cdn.educba.com/academy/wp-content/uploads/2019/02/How-to-Install-Matlab.jpg) # 摘要 本文详细介绍并演示了使用MATLAB及其M_map工具箱进行数据可视化和地图投影的高级应用。首先,对M_map工具进行了基础介绍,并概述了数据可视化的重要性及设计原则。接着,本研究深入探讨了M_map工具的地图投影理论与配置方法,包括投影类型的选择和自定义地图样式。文章进一步展示了通过M_map实现的多维数据可视化技巧,包括时间序列和空间

【高效旋转图像:DELPHI实现指南】:精通从基础到高级的旋转技巧

![【高效旋转图像:DELPHI实现指南】:精通从基础到高级的旋转技巧](https://www.knowcomputing.com/wp-content/uploads/2023/05/double-buffering.jpg) # 摘要 DELPHI编程语言为图像处理提供了丰富的功能和强大的支持,尤其是在图像旋转方面。本文首先介绍DELPHI图像处理的基础知识,然后深入探讨基础和高级图像旋转技术。文中详细阐述了图像类和对象的使用、基本图像旋转算法、性能优化方法,以及第三方库的应用。此外,文章还讨论了图像旋转在实际应用中的实现,包括用户界面的集成、多种图像格式支持以及自动化处理。针对疑难问

无线网络信号干扰:识别并解决测试中的秘密敌人!

![无线网络信号干扰:识别并解决测试中的秘密敌人!](https://m.media-amazon.com/images/I/51cUtBn9CjL._AC_UF1000,1000_QL80_DpWeblab_.jpg) # 摘要 无线网络信号干扰是影响无线通信质量与性能的关键问题,本文从理论基础、检测识别方法、应对策略以及实战案例四个方面深入探讨了无线信号干扰的各个方面。首先,本文概述了无线信号干扰的分类、机制及其对网络性能和安全的影响,并分析了不同无线网络标准中对干扰的管理和策略。其次,文章详细介绍了现场测试和软件工具在干扰检测与识别中的应用,并探讨了利用AI技术提升识别效率的潜力。然后

模拟与仿真专家:台达PLC在WPLSoft中的进阶技巧

![模拟与仿真专家:台达PLC在WPLSoft中的进阶技巧](https://plc4me.com/wp-content/uploads/2019/12/wpllogo-1.png) # 摘要 本文全面介绍了台达PLC及WPLSoft编程环境,强调了WPLSoft编程基础与高级应用的重要性,以及模拟与仿真技巧在提升台达PLC性能中的关键作用。文章深入探讨了台达PLC在工业自动化和智能建筑等特定行业中的应用,并通过案例分析,展示了理论与实践的结合。此外,本文还展望了技术进步对台达PLC未来发展趋势的影响,包括工业物联网(IIoT)和人工智能(AI)技术的应用前景,并讨论了面临的挑战与机遇,提出

【ZYNQ外围设备驱动开发】:实现硬件与软件无缝对接的专家教程

![【ZYNQ外围设备驱动开发】:实现硬件与软件无缝对接的专家教程](https://read.nxtbook.com/ieee/electrification/electrification_june_2023/assets/015454eadb404bf24f0a2c1daceb6926.jpg) # 摘要 ZYNQ平台是一种集成了ARM处理器和FPGA的异构处理系统,广泛应用于需要高性能和定制逻辑的应用场合。本文详细介绍了ZYNQ平台的软件架构和外围设备驱动开发的基础知识,包括硬件抽象层的作用、驱动程序与内核的关系以及开发工具的使用。同时,本文深入探讨了外围设备驱动实现的技术细节,如设

Calibre与Python脚本:自动化验证流程的最佳实践

![Calibre](https://d33v4339jhl8k0.cloudfront.net/docs/assets/55d7809ae4b089486cadde84/images/5fa474cc4cedfd001610a33b/file-vD9qk72bjE.png) # 摘要 随着集成电路设计的复杂性日益增加,自动化验证流程的需求也在不断上升。本文首先介绍了Calibre和Python脚本集成的基础,探讨了Calibre的基本使用和自动化脚本编写的基础知识。接着,通过实践应用章节,深入分析了Calibre脚本在设计规则检查、版图对比和验证中的应用,以及Python脚本在自定义报告生

字符串处理的艺术:C语言字符数组与字符串函数的应用秘笈

![字符串处理的艺术:C语言字符数组与字符串函数的应用秘笈](https://img-blog.csdnimg.cn/af7aa1f9aff7414aa5dab033fb9a6a3c.png?x-oss-process=image/watermark,type_ZHJvaWRzYW5zZmFsbGJhY2s,shadow_50,text_Q1NETiBA54K554Gv5aSn5bGO,size_20,color_FFFFFF,t_70,g_se,x_16#pic_center) # 摘要 C语言中的字符数组和字符串处理是基础且关键的部分,涉及到程序设计的许多核心概念。本文从基本概念出发,深